Understanding the different connectivity varieties is the primary step in making an informed determination. Cellular, Wi-Fi, Bluetooth, LoRaWAN, and Zigbee are among the varied technologies obtainable. Each has its strengths and weaknesses, making it essential to judge which best aligns with your organizational targets and constraints.


Cellular connectivity offers broad protection and sturdy reliability, ideal for applications requiring mobile connectivity. Businesses with assets that move over giant distances typically depend on cellular networks due to their established infrastructure. However, costs can escalate depending on information utilization, making it important to evaluate the potential bills when integrating cellular solutions.


Wi-Fi, whereas familiar to many, presents each opportunities and challenges. The availability of existing Wi-Fi infrastructure can scale back implementation costs. However, Wi-Fi connections may be prone to interference and may not cowl giant areas successfully. For businesses working in dense city environments or areas with various physical limitations, the reliability of service could presumably be a priority.

Bluetooth technology serves a function in scenarios the place short-range communication suffices. It is a superb choice for connecting devices within a confined area, making it in style for private gadgets and wearables. While Bluetooth tends to have low power consumption, its restricted vary can pose issues in purposes requiring widespread device connectivity.


LoRaWAN has gained recognition for its long-range capabilities and low power necessities. This technology is especially efficient for rural and remote applications, where different connectivity choices may fall brief. Many agricultural and environmental monitoring businesses go for LoRaWAN, as it might possibly assist an enormous community of devices while preserving costs manageable.


Zigbee is another contender, primarily used for smart house and industrial functions. It is well-suited for connecting a number of units over quick distances, making it efficient for constructing automation and sensor networks - IoT Connectivity Issues. The main advantage lies in its mesh networking capabilities, allowing units to relay data across a community. However, it depends closely on proximity, which may restrict flexibility in bigger setups.


Security is a paramount concern when selecting IoT connectivity. Various technologies provide completely different ranges of encryption and security protocols. Understanding the vulnerabilities associated with each type is crucial. Implementing extra safety measures on the applying and network layers can also help mitigate risks. Businesses must prioritize knowledge safety, as breaches can have devastating consequences.

Latency is another critical issue to think about in your IoT structure. For functions necessitating real-time knowledge transmission, similar to autonomous vehicles or healthcare monitoring techniques, low-latency choices turn out to be non-negotiable. Cellular and certain kinds of Wi-Fi can ship the required speeds, while others like LoRaWAN may introduce delays that might compromise operational efficiency.
